WHAT IS THE COASTAL CLEANUP?
The Coastal Cleanup event organizes groups of people to scatter across the city of Gloucester to collect garbage, debris, and waste materials that wash up on shore or that exist in these coastal areas. We organize groups to cover several of the beaches here in Gloucester. This is part of a larger effort across the state, the country, and around the world! As we gather trash, we’ll be keeping track of what we collect with a special CoastSweep app. This app will forward the data through the Massachusetts' CoastSweep program, and the data eventually goes to Ocean Conservancy — a multinational organization that tracks debris patterns, implements environmental policies, and advocate for environmental stewardship with governments across the globe.
